encode()方法语法: str.encode(encoding='UTF-8',errors='strict') 参数 encoding -- 要使用的编码,如: UTF-8。 errors -- 设置不同错误的处理方案。默认为 'strict',意为编码错误引起一个UnicodeError。 其他可能得值有 'ignore', 'replace', 'xmlcharrefreplace', 'backslashreplace' 以及通过 codecs.r...
2、str.encode(encoding='UTF-8',errors='strict) encoding -- 要使用的编码,如: UTF-8。 errors -- 设置不同错误的处理方案。默认为 'strict',意为编码错误引起一个UnicodeError。 其他可能得值有 'ignore', 'replace', 'xmlcharrefreplace', 'backslashreplace' 以及通过 codecs.register_error() 注册的...
encoding="utf-8": 可选参数,用于指定进行转码时采用的字符编码,默认为UTF-8。只有这一参数时可以将“encodeing=”省略。 errors="strict": 可选参数,用于指定错误处理方式,其可选择值可以是①strict(遇到非法字符就抛出异常)、②ignore(忽略非法字符)、 ③replace(用"?"代替非法字符)、④xmlcharrefreplace(使用...
str.encode(encoding="utf-8", errors="strict") 以字节对象的形式返回字符串的编码版本。默认编码是“utf-8”。 给出errors参数来设置不同的错误处理方案。errors的默认值是'strict',这意味着编码错误会引发UnicodeError。其他可能的值是'ignore','replace','xmlcharrefreplace','backslashreplace'和通过codecs.r...
1. encoding:指定字符串的编码方式,默认为'utf-8'。_x000D_ 2. errors:指定编码错误处理方式,默认为'strict'。_x000D_ 3. newline:指定换行符,默认为'\n'。_x000D_ 4. sep:指定分隔符,默认为' '。_x000D_ 5. end:指定结尾符,默认为'\n'。_x000D_ 二、Python str函数参数的用法_x...
str.encode(encoding="utf-8", errors="strict") 返回原字符串编码为字节串对象的版本。 默认编码为 'utf-8’。 可以给出 errors 来设置不同的错误处理方案。 errors 的默认值为 'strict',表示编码错误会引发 UnicodeError。 其他可用的值为 'ignore', 'replace', 'xmlcharrefreplace', 'backslashreplace' ...
str.encode(encoding="utf-8", errors="strict") 返回原字符串编码为字节串对象的版本。默认编码为 'utf-8’。 可以给出 errors 来设置不同的错误处理方案。errors 的默认值为 'strict',表示编码错误会引发 UnicodeError。 其他可用的值为 'ignore', 'replace', 'xmlcharrefreplace', 'backslashreplace' 以及...
5.encode()方法 用于将字符串编码为指定的字节序列。它接受一个字符串参数,表示要使用的编码格式,并返回一个字节对象。errors参数可以指定不同的错误处理方案。 # 语法: str.encode(encoding='UTF-8',errors='strict') # 案例1: str_data = "hello world" print(str_data.encode("GBK")) # 输出:结果为...
str.encode(encoding="utf-8", errors="strict") 返回原字符串编码为字节串对象的版本。 默认编码为 'utf-8’。 可以给出 errors 来设置不同的错误处理方案。 errors 的默认值为 'strict',表示编码错误会引发 UnicodeError。 其他可用的值为 'ignore', 'replace', 'xmlcharrefreplace', 'backslashreplace' ...
string.encode(encoding='UTF-8', errors='strict') #以 encoding 指定的编码格式编码 string,如果出错默认报一个ValueError 的异常,除非 errors 指定的是'ignore'或者'replace' string.endswith(obj, beg=0, end=len(string)) #检查字符串是否以 obj 结束,如果beg 或者 end 指定则检查指定的范围内是否以 obj...